Printed quad-band CPW-fed slot antenna

Abstract: This article focuses on the design of a CPW-fed slot multiband antenna at frequency bands of 2.4, 3.5, 5.2, and 5.8 GHz, compliant the bandwidth requirements of the services that operate in these bands. The antenna is printed on a 30 × 32 mm2 FR-4 substrate with thickness of 1.5 mm. Resonances are achieved by the use of a combination of slots of different geometries. The measured and simulated results prove that the proposed antenna is suitable for LTE, M-WiMAX, Bluetooth, and WLAN applications.
